Transaction 66985e2262bdfafea2cffd529390d12efdf27809adde4cd39dd5d9376ae2a1af
1 Input
1 Output
-
66985e2262bdfafea2cffd529390d12efdf27809adde4cd39dd5d9376ae2a1af:0
- value
- 334376233
- script pubkey
- OP_0 OP_PUSHBYTES_20 824a04700c947485a0ed0af9a594fa572b09e50a
- address
- bc1qsf9qguqvj36gtg8dptu6t9862u4sneg2mk4jxu